To The Daily Sun,

I volunteer at the Belknap Mill Museum and was heartbroken to see the vandalism that has just occurred. Three of our windows have been smashed. Why? The Mill has served Laconia so long, and so well. Have readers visited an art exhibit there? Attended a wedding? Perhaps brought their kids to the free musicals during summer programming? Have they taken a class in knitting or felting? Taken the tour with a school group?

The Mill does so much to try to serve the community. If readers do value what the Mill has given, may I ask them to join me in donating to the window repair fund? Our insurance deductible is very high, and is almost as much as the repair. We need help to continue to try to serve Laconia. Please, please go to belknapmill.org to help.

Kathleen Anderson

New Hampton
